Sun Cluster Quorum Server

Már a Sun Cluster írásnál megemlítettem a Quorum szerepét. Gyors ismétlésként elmondom, hogy ez az „eszköz” felel a kérdéses helyzetek-szavazások döntésében. Sun Cluster esetében tradicionálisan Quorum Disk-eket használunk, viszont újabb technológiaként megjelent az TCP/IP alapokon funkciónáló Quorum Server „service”. Akkor nézzük, hogyan lehet beüzemelni.

Előnyök, ha Quorum Disk és SCSI rezerváció helyett TCP/IP alapú Quorum Server Service-t építünk:

    – Nem kell hozzá SCSI DISK (NAS használatakor pl).
    – Egy Quorum Server esetében több instance több cluster-t is kiszolgálhat.

Hátrányok:

    – Kell külön rendszer, OS erre a célra.
    – A Qurom Server és Clusterek között (illik) dedikált hálózati kapcsolatot biztosítani.

Quorum Server Telepítése

Szükségünk lesz egy Sun Cluster telepítőre

    # ls -lah |grep cluster

Tömörítsük ki a telepítő archív file-t

    # unzip suncluster-3_2u3-ga-solaris-x86.zip

Nem szükséges telepítenünk az egész Sun Cluster-t, menjünk a következő helyre a telepítőn belül

    # cd Solaris_x86/Product/sun_cluster_qs/Solaris_10/Packages/

Elméletileg a következő három csomagra van szükségünk az alap Quorum Server telepítéséhez:

    SUNWscqsman
    SUNWscqsr
    SUNWscqsu

Telepítsük a megfelelő csomagokat

    # pkgadd -d . SUNWscqsman SUNWscqsr SUNWscqsu

Telepítés után a következő helyen lévő két binárist kell hogy lássuk

    # ls -lah /usr/cluster/bin/

Quorum Server Konfigurálása

Egyetlen egy config file-t kell editálnunk. Ebben is az instance-ket lehet definiálni. Ahány sort felvezetünk, annyi instance-t definiálunk. Minden instance-hez meg kell adnunk, az instance nevét, a portot ahol figyeljen, illetve azt a könyvtárat ahol a quorum server tárolhatja a futáshoz szükséges információkat.

    # cat /etc/scqsd/scqsd.conf

A default file alkalmas az indításra, csupán akkor kell szerkesztenünk, ha ezen változtatni szeretnénk.

Quorum Server Indítása

A következő szintaxissal lehet egy quorum servert indítani:

    # /usr/cluster/bin/clquorumserver start [instance]

Amennyiben nem definiáljuk, melyik instance-t akarjuk elindítani, akkor használhatjuk a „+” jelet, úgy mindet el fogja indítani, amely be volt jegyezve a config-ban.

Quorum Server Leállítása

Leállítani pedig az indításhoz hasonló szintaxissal lehet, csupán a start szó helyett a stoppot kell használni.

Quorum Reservációs Kulcsol törlése

Ha van egy Quorum serverünk, amiben vannak már kulcsok is, akkor a következő képpen tudunk kulcsokat törölni manuálisan ha szükséges:

    # clquorumserver clear -c sc-cluster -I 0x4308D2CF 9000
    The quorum server to be unconfigured must have been removed from the cluster.
    Unconfiguring a valid quorum server could compromise the cluster quorum. Do you
    want to continue? (yes or no) y

A SUN hivatalos dokumentációja a Quorum Serverről elérhető itt.

Vélemény, hozzászólás?

Az e-mail címet nem tesszük közzé. A kötelező mezőket * karakterrel jelöltük